Просмотр исходного кода

Merge pull request #393 from rashidkpc/master

Fix for count positioning in firefox
Rashid Khan 12 лет назад
Родитель
Сommit
a1df0fc15f
1 измененных файлов с 8 добавлено и 3 удалено
  1. 8 3
      panels/table/micropanel.html

+ 8 - 3
panels/table/micropanel.html

@@ -19,13 +19,18 @@
         <i class="pointer icon-ban-circle" ng-click="build_search(micropanel.field,field[0],true);dismiss();"></i>
       </td>
       <td class="progress" style="width:100px;position:relative">
-        <div bs-tooltip="percent(field[1],data.length)" class="bar {{micropanelColor($index)}}" ng-style="{width: percent(field[1],data.length)}"></div>
-        <span style="position:absolute;right:10px;">{{field[1]}}</span>
+        <style scoped>
+          .progress {
+            overflow: visible;
+          }
+        </style>
+        <div bs-tooltip="percent(field[1],data.length)" class="bar" ng-class="micropanelColor($index)" ng-style="{width: percent(field[1],data.length)}"></div>
+        <span style="position:absolute;right:20px;">{{field[1]}}</span>
       </td>
     </tr>
   </tbody>
 </table>
 <div class="progress">
-  <div ng-repeat='field in micropanel.values' bs-tooltip="field[0]+' ('+percent(field[1],data.length)+')'" class="bar {{micropanelColor($index)}}" ng-style="{width: percent(field[1],data.length)};"></div>
+  <div ng-repeat='field in micropanel.values' data-position="right" bs-tooltip="field[0]+' ('+percent(field[1],data.length)+')'" class="bar {{micropanelColor($index)}}" ng-style="{width: percent(field[1],data.length)};"></div>
 </div>
 <span ng-repeat='(field,count) in micropanel.related'><a ng-click="toggle_field(field)">{{field}}</a> ({{Math.round((count / micropanel.count) * 100)}}%), </span>